FAQs for finding a family daycare near you in Oak Grove, KY
What should I look for in a family daycare near me in Oak Grove, KY?
When looking for a family daycare near you in Oak Grove, KY, the most important thing to consider is the safety, comfort, and well-being of your child. Depending on your family's needs, make sure to inquire about the family daycare provider's experience in caring for children of similar ages. Ask about their qualifications, resources available for learning and development, such as toys or educational materials. Additionally, consider inquiring about how the family daycare provider structures their days; if they provide meals or snacks; and if they allow you to have a tour of their facility. It is also important that you feel comfortable with the family daycare provider and that they understand your family's values and priorities. Taking these points into consideration when selecting a family daycare can help ensure that your child has a safe and nurturing environment in which to thrive.
How do I know if a family daycare provider near me in Oak Grove, KY is right for my family?
When selecting a family daycare provider, families may want to consider factors such as location, value for costs, hours of operation, and licensing requirements and monitoring standards. Additionally, it is worth evaluating any safety regulations in place at the facility and paying attention to reviews from past or current clients. Upon visiting the family daycare near you in Oak Grove, KY, there should be a sense that it is clean and well-organized, and the staff should be friendly and welcoming. All of these aspects help ensure that not only are the family's needs met and children are receiving the best possible care.
What are some tips for choosing a family daycare provider near me in Oak Grove, KY?
When choosing family daycare near you in Oak Grove, KY, it is essential to be thorough! Consider what's most important to you and when choosing a child care provider, and don't be afraid to ask questions when interviewing potential daycares. You should also schedule a visit to meet with the family daycare provider and observe the environment. You may ask them questions such as: How does the daycare staff interact with the children? Are there toys, materials, and appropriate activities for the age group of children in their care? Are there any qualifications, certifications, background checks, and child-to-adult ratio of staff information they can share with you? All of these questions as well as any additional considerations that are important to you should help you make an informed decision.
